Comprehending the Importance of Window and Door Replacements
Windows and doors work as the main points of insulation, security, and design for any home. Over time, natural wear and tear, weather condition conditions, and outdated designs can result in substantial energy loss and decreased aesthetics.
Advantages of Replacing Windows and Doors
Energy Efficiency: New windows and doors are frequently developed with sophisticated innovations that enhance insulation. This decreases cooling and heating expenses substantially.

Improved Security: Modern materials and locking systems improve the security of a home, hindering potential break-ins.

Increased Aesthetic Appeal: Updated windows and doors can considerably improve the look of a home, making it more appealing both within and out.

Increased Home Value: Replacing old windows and doors can increase the general resale value of a residential or commercial property, appealing to possible purchasers.

Noise Reduction: Quality replacements can minimize outside noise, adding to a more serene living environment.

UV Protection: Many modern windows come with UV-blocking features that protect furnishings and floor covering from fading due to sun exposure.

1. How do I understand if I need to change my windows or doors?Signs include drafts, condensation, rotting materials, broken glass, or trouble opening and closing.

2. What is the typical expense of window and door replacements?Costs can differ commonly based on products, labor, and the scope of work, however generally vary from ₤ 300 to over ₤ 1,000 per unit.

3. How long does the installation procedure take?Installation can typically be completed in one to two days, depending upon the number of doors and windows being replaced.

4. Are replacement windows energy-efficient?Numerous modern-day windows are created with energy-efficiency in mind, including Low-E glass and insulation methods that can substantially minimize energy costs.

5. Can I install windows or doors myself?While some property owners might select DIY setups, professional installation is suggested to ensure appropriate fitting and weatherproofing.
